Bumble's Recent Financial Challenges
In early 2024, Bumble's management publicly acknowledged disappointing financial results for the last quarter of the preceding year. During an earnings call, they revealed that the new Premium Plus subscription tier, which launched in late 2022, lacked a suitable market fit. This admission led to an adjusted downward financial outlook for the company for 2024.
As a direct consequence, Bumble's share price dropped significantly, closing at $11.23 a share after reflecting a $1.95 decline in value. Such financial struggles raise concerns among shareholders about the company's operational decisions and market direction.
The Impact of Financial Disclosures
In August 2024, Bumble's stock again suffered following the release of mixed second-quarter earnings. Management's updates indicated further challenges with the app relaunch and intentions to reassess their subscription service offerings, particularly pausing plans to revamp the poorly received Premium Plus tier. This affected investor confidence, leading to another substantial drop in stock value, closing at $5.71 after losing $2.35 per share the day after the announcement.
